Caleidoscope: A Pop-Up Photo Exhibition by the OIST Photographic Society

Description
The Photographic Society is back with our inaugural collective exhibition: Caleidoscope.
This collection features photographs that vary in technique, proficiency, and personality, yet unknowingly explore similar emotions. These images silently connect, mirroring each other from the surrounding landscape to the most introspective reflections of self, captured in a sparkle of bokeh.
This is not the kaleidoscope you might expect, but a transliteration that invites you to look closely for patterns, colors, shapes, shadows, and dots that catch your eye. Whether you like or dislike a particular image for unknown reasons, lose yourself in each photo and enjoy the visual conversations we've set for you.
We are a group of OIST-based photographers with diverse backgrounds and an unyielding passion for photography. We strive to go beyond the usual club boundaries by forming a Photography Collective in Okinawa. Our aim is to develop an artistic vision that is not necessarily defined by our scientific endeavors, but by the unique ideas and concepts that arise when a common interest provides an outlet for our artistic souls through a visual technique that has proven timeless and is so conspicuous in today’s world that we rarely stop to look twice.
